An action comedy centered on Blubberella, an overweight half-vampire woman whose footsteps cause explosions and whose dual swords are used against anyone who makes fun of her. She must face an army of undead Nazi soldiers in her valiant struggle against bloodshed and tyranny.

Lindsay Hollister is the lead actress playing a half human / half vampire living in 1940 Nazi Germany... in her perfectly normal 2011 apartment with a smartphone, net access, Mac computer and I do know what insert Apple product here... Yes it's that kind of movie. The movie is a shot for shot parody of Blood Rayne 3. I think you can guess what the joke is from that horrendous title.Sadly this movie only works as an inside joke as all the "funny" bits were simply to change one thing from the shot of the original movie. If you don't have that movie memorize or even bothered to see it then you won't get the joke... and see how anti humor it is. Make no mistake. This movie is offensive and the director went that extra mile to humiliate the lead actress for being plus size because.... I don't know maybe he thinks pointing at people that aren't stick figures is funny? It's a shame because she's actually good and totally wasted in this heap of trash. Then you have Willam Belli who is simply FABULOUS! but no, here he is made to act the typical 90's gay friend and then black face... there is an actor with black face in a 2011 movie. I'm serious!This movie was bad, offensive and weird. If you know what you're in for then you'll get a few laughs out of it. Mostly for the wrong reasons but you can still have some stupid fun with it. If on the other hand you are unfamiliar with this director's work or blood rayne then take out your electric fan and will the stench of this heap away. You WILL hate it .

This is the sort of low budget movie that normally goes nowhere but on the strength of its comedy alone, it's actually fun to watch! Perhaps the only movie made out of another movie (except "What's Up, Tiger Lily", this film is a parody of "Bloodrayne: The Third Reich" using the same cast and crew but is eminently more watchable. Less ridiculous than the "Naked Gun" movies, it's a farce but a very clever one. It shows just how much you can do with a sense of humor and some "good" writing. The star shows a very rare ability to make fun of herself in an age where "fat" jokes and every other sort of politically incorrect humor has been banned by the "culture Nazis". Enjoy!

A bit like an Aaron Seltzer/Jason Friedberg movie. Not really a superhero film although it realises that in a voice-over of the credits. Where should I start with this title? With Uwe Boll's rampage, I was hoping for something better, but was stuck with trash. Apparently this is a money making movie, as he fronts his own production company and shot this and Bloodrayne scene for scene. He mocks/parodies his own movie whilst putting in sex jokes, food, flatulence, and pop culture references. This movie was immature but made be chuckle at some bits. (rosebud, resistance fighter 1 ETC).However, you have to see this as it is. Light entertainment for those with low IQ. It stands on its own feet as a film and contains some funny references to film making, which often breaks the third wall. Sadly too often, but if your a Boll fanatic this is worth a rent. Its use in title cards was effective, and most the time the wacky music set the tone perfectly. The actors were more suited to this than its counterpart, as the goofy feeling of the film even allowed Clint Howard's character not to annoy me. That being said there was an obligatory homosexual, and this film really felt to me like an attempt to follow a spoof formulae, as the film failed to live up to its premise (IE, the beginning which was of higher quality).In conclusion, it was some funny moments, but they are over done for the dumb. By the way, the protagonist is a fat vampire. Its really hard to remember that throughout the film.
